Components of Central Systems
- Furnace: Responsible for heating air, typically powered by gas or electricity.
- Air Conditioner: Cools air using a refrigerant cycle.
- Ductwork: Distributes heated or cooled air throughout the home.
- Thermostat: Controls the system, allowing you to set your desired temperature.

FAQs
What is the average lifespan of a central heat and air system?
Typically, a well-maintained system lasts between 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can help extend its lifespan.
How often should a central system be serviced?
It's recommended to service your system at least once a year, preferably before the heating or cooling season begins.
